Introduction to circular water bath nitrogen blowing instrument
Introduce the circular water bath nitrogen blower:
The circular water bath nitrogen blowing instrument consists of a chassis, a central rod, a sample positioning frame, a gas distribution system, etc. The test tube is fixed by a positioning frame spring and a tray, and the sample grade is labeled with a number. The gas passes through an adjustable flow meter to the gas distribution system, and then through an elastic hose to various grade needle valve tubes. The needle valve tubes can be adjusted up and down according to the size of the test tube and the amount of solvent, and then the gas is blown towards the surface of the solution by the needle, causing the solvent to evaporate rapidly.
The circular water bath nitrogen blower includes a main unit, a sample holder, and a gas distribution system. The test tube is fixed in position by a spring-loaded test tube clamp and support plate. Each sample position is numbered. The gas enters the gas distribution manifold, and the flexible air duct guides the gas into the valve air duct interface at each position. According to the size of the test tube and the amount of solvent, each airway can be independently raised and lowered to the desired height. Usually, a nitrogen blower is used instead of the commonly used rotary evaporator for concentration. The nitrogen blower can concentrate dozens of samples simultaneously, greatly reducing sample preparation time, and has the characteristics of time-saving, easy operation, and speed.

The circular water bath nitrogen blower utilizes nitrogen gas, which is an inert gas that can isolate oxygen, enhance air flow around it, and increase its temperature to prevent oxidation. At the same time, the bottom is heated while the top is purged with nitrogen or air. The rapid flow of nitrogen can break the gas-liquid equilibrium above the liquid, accelerating the evaporation and concentration rate of the liquid. Therefore, the main function of the nitrogen blower is to achieve rapid concentration of the sample. This method has the characteristics of time-saving, convenience, and accuracy.
The circular water bath nitrogen blowing instrument has emerged, which not only solves all the disadvantages of using a rotary evaporator, especially for small and multiple samples, but also becomes a necessary instrument for every chemical laboratory. For samples that cannot be heated or even require cooling and concentration, only a nitrogen blower can be used for concentration.
